Application of Large Language Models in Chronic Disease Care: Mixed Methods Systematic Review and Thematic Synthesis

Summary
Large language models show promise for chronic disease management, enhancing patient education and self-care. However, foundational safety and system integration challenges require further attention for effective real-world application.
Area of Science:
- Artificial Intelligence in Healthcare
- Digital Health
- Nursing Informatics
Background:
- Chronic diseases represent a significant global health burden, necessitating continuous and personalized long-term management.
- Traditional healthcare models struggle to provide the sustained support required for chronic disease care.
- Large language models (LLMs) offer potential for scalable, interactive support in chronic disease management.
Purpose of the Study:
- To systematically review evidence on LLM technical performance, applications, and challenges in chronic disease care.
- To critically evaluate LLMs using a theory-driven, 3D framework based on Orem's Self-Care Theory.
Main Methods:
- A mixed-methods systematic review following PRISMA 2020 and SWiM guidelines.
- Comprehensive literature search across multiple databases from inception to April 2026.
- Thematic synthesis of 20 moderate-to-high quality studies using NVivo 14, guided by Orem's 3D framework.
Main Results:
- Three core themes emerged: foundational safety/privacy, self-care enablement, and design/integration challenges.
- LLMs showed strength in patient education and decision support, enhanced by retrieval-augmented generation (RAG) and fine-tuning.
- Barriers included content readability, hallucination risks, and ethical ambiguities, limiting real-world readiness.
Conclusions:
- This review provides the first theory-driven, nursing-informed evaluation of LLMs in chronic care.
- Evidence primarily supports LLM capabilities in self-care enablement, with deficiencies in safety and integration.
- Future nursing research should focus on safety, health-literacy-adaptive design, and implementation science for equitable patient-centered care.
